Top OpenFOAM Alternatives for CFD Simulation
OpenFOAM is a highly respected and widely used free, open-source software for Computational Fluid Dynamics (CFD). Developed by the OpenFOAM Foundation and distributed under the GPL, it offers users unparalleled freedom to modify and redistribute the software, ensuring continued free use. However, even with its extensive capabilities, engineers and researchers often seek out OpenFOAM alternatives for various reasons, including specific feature requirements, different user interfaces, or integration with existing workflows. This article explores some of the leading alternatives available.

Elmer
Elmer is a robust open-source multiphysical simulation software, primarily developed by CSC - IT Center for Science. As a Free and Open Source solution available on Mac, Windows, and Linux, it's a strong OpenFOAM alternative, offering comprehensive features in Electromagnetics, CFD, and Finite Element Method (FEM).

SimFlow
SimFlow is a powerful commercial CFD software for Windows and Linux, specifically designed for engineering and science. It stands out as an OpenFOAM alternative by combining an intuitive user interface with the benefits of the open-source OpenFOAM® engine, making it excellent for CAE, Heat flow, CFD, and Finite element simulations.

KRATOS Multiphysics
Kratos Multiphysics, also known as Kratos, is a Free and Open Source framework for building parallel multi-disciplinary simulation software, accessible on Mac, Windows, and Linux. Its focus on Modularity, extensibility, and High-Performance Computing (HPC) makes it a compelling OpenFOAM alternative, especially for CFD simulations and Python integration.

COMSOL Multiphysics
COMSOL Multiphysics is a commercial engineering, design, and finite element analysis software environment for the modeling and simulation of any physics-based system. Available on Mac, Windows, and Linux, it's a top-tier OpenFOAM alternative for those needing comprehensive multiphysics modeling, CAE, CFD, finite element analysis, and heat flow simulations.

CFDTool
CFDTool™ is a Freemium, fully integrated, and dedicated MATLAB® Computational Fluid Dynamics (CFD) Toolbox. For users on Mac, Windows, and Linux familiar with MATLAB, it provides a portable OpenFOAM alternative with features like CAE, CFD, and one-click installation for modeling and simulation of fluid flows.

ANSYS Fluent
ANSYS Fluent is a leading commercial CFD software for Windows, offering broad physical modeling capabilities for flow, turbulence, heat transfer, and reactions in industrial applications. As a premier OpenFOAM alternative, it provides advanced CFD and finite element simulation tools.

FEATool Multiphysics
FEATool Multiphysics is a Free Personal, fully integrated Finite Element FEM CAE simulation toolbox for Matlab, compatible with Mac, Windows, Linux, and GNU Octave. It’s an excellent portable OpenFOAM alternative for easily modeling and simulating heat transfer, fluid flow, and more, providing comprehensive CAE, CFD, FEM, and simulation features.

FEATFLOW
FEATFLOW is a Free and Open Source program package for Mac, Windows, and Linux, offering both a user-oriented and general-purpose subroutine system for the numerical solution of incompressible Navier-Stokes equations. It serves as a valuable OpenFOAM alternative for those seeking robust CAE, CFD, finite element, and simulation capabilities.

COSMOSWorks
COSMOSWorks provides easy-to-use yet powerful commercial design validation and optimization tools for designers and engineers on Windows. While more focused on general FEA, its strong finite element and simulation features make it a viable OpenFOAM alternative for design-centric analyses.

Simcenter STAR-CCM+
Simcenter STAR-CCM+ is a leading commercial Computational Fluid Dynamics (CFD) Software and Finite Element Analysis (FEA) Software for Windows and Linux. It offers comprehensive CFD, finite element, prototyping, and simulation features, making it a powerful OpenFOAM alternative for complex industrial applications.
